What Makes Recumbent Trikes Special?

Recumbent trikes stand out for their unique design that prioritizes comfort and stability. Unlike traditional bicycles, they feature a reclined seating position, allowing riders to distribute weight evenly across the seat. This ergonomic layout reduces stress on the back and joints, making long rides more enjoyable.

Their three-wheel configuration enhances balance and safety, especially for those who may struggle with two-wheeled options. Riders can navigate various terrains confidently without fear of tipping over.

Additionally, recumbent trikes encourage a more relaxed pedaling posture. This not only makes riding less strenuous but also allows users to pedal efficiently while enjoying scenic routes at their own pace.
